Step 1: Pre-review qualification
Before we begin testing, we screen casinos for minimum eligibility. We do not review casinos that are unlicensed, blacklisted, or have a known history of fraud, delayed payments, or regulatory penalties. We verify licensing by checking the official records of regulatory bodies such as the Malta Gaming Authority, UK Gambling Commission, Curaçao eGaming, or others depending on the jurisdiction. Only casinos that pass this first test proceed to a full review.
Step 2: Structured research
Our team gathers and documents the core data of the casino: license number, license holder, owner, physical address, software providers, supported languages, countries of operation, accepted payment systems, terms and conditions, bonus terms, and privacy policies. This helps us establish the baseline structure of the site and spot anything suspicious early.
Step 3: User experience audit
We register a new player account using clean, unique credentials. We then log the signup process — including how long it takes, whether any sensitive information is required upfront, if phone or email verification is used, and if any issues arise. This helps us measure accessibility, usability, and security from the first contact.
Step 4: Deposit and bonus testing
We make a real-money deposit, usually using two or more payment options such as Visa, Skrill, or crypto. We check for hidden fees, processing times, and whether the bonus is automatically added or must be claimed manually. Once the bonus is activated, we review the bonus terms in action: wagering requirements, maximum bets, eligible games, and time limits.
Step 5: Gameplay analysis
Using a sample of games from different providers (e.g., NetEnt, Play’n GO, Pragmatic Play, Evolution), we assess game loading times, user interface, mobile performance, and fairness labels like RTP visibility or RNG certification. If games crash, lag, or underperform — we report it.
Step 6: Withdrawal test
After meeting or bypassing bonus requirements, we request a withdrawal of the remaining balance. This step includes reviewing the identity verification process (KYC), withdrawal method availability, fee transparency, payout speed, and customer support response time if needed. We document each part of this process with timestamps and screenshots.
Step 7: Customer support test
We contact customer support via live chat, email, or phone (if available). We ask realistic questions about bonus usage, payment issues, and account restrictions. We grade responses based on speed, clarity, friendliness, and accuracy. We also log working hours and whether multilingual support is offered.
Step 8: Reputation cross-checking
Our team checks casino-related forums, Trustpilot, player complaint databases, Reddit threads, and watchdog platforms to gauge public sentiment. If patterns of unresolved complaints emerge, we downgrade the reputation score — even if our own experience was smooth. Community data matters.
Step 9: Responsible gambling features
We test whether players can easily set deposit, loss, or time limits; self-exclude; or request reality checks. If these tools are hidden, ineffective, or purely decorative, we flag it. We value platforms that promote healthy play habits and offer resources for users at risk.
Step 10: Multi-review verification
Every review draft is checked by another team member who didn’t participate in testing. This fresh set of eyes reviews for bias, factual accuracy, and clarity. The reviewer double-checks numbers (e.g., wagering amounts, payout times) and ensures that player-facing language is used — no legalese or filler allowed.
Step 11: Score assignment
Each casino is rated across several core categories:
Licensing and trustworthiness
Deposit and withdrawal processes
Bonus fairness
Game variety and provider quality
User experience (desktop and mobile)
Customer support
Responsible gambling tools
User reputation
Each category has a weight in the final score. For example, license and withdrawal reliability carry more weight than design or layout. Scores are aggregated and displayed on a 10-point scale with decimal precision (e.g., 8.4/10).
Step 12: Publication and tagging
After all checks are complete, the review is published with all relevant metadata: country tags, provider tags, bonus categories, support channels, and review date. Players can filter or sort based on this data, increasing usability.
Step 13: Scheduled review updates
We revisit every live review at least once every 3 months — more often if we detect change signals (e.g., broken links, player complaints, license changes). We adjust scores when policies change, T&Cs shift, or performance declines. We display the latest update date to ensure users are viewing current data.
Step 14: Player feedback integration
We allow players to submit experience reports, which we review internally. Multiple reports about the same issue trigger an internal re-review. Verified problems result in updated content and possibly a drop in ranking.
Step 15: Ethical compliance and disclosures
We clearly label sponsored placements, ensure affiliate links do not affect rankings, and maintain a strict firewall between the content and partnership teams. If a casino pays for advertising but fails a review — it’s rejected. Our writers never have contact with commercial staff.
